The port authority was in the process of making a new pier and the passengers were forced to walk on a very unsafe and unlevel area (with cement mixers and other vehicle traffic) just to try to get to the area of the pier at the end of the ship to go into Isafjordur. My husband was the SECOND passenger to fall and be injured in the area the first passenger fell; and we understand that there was a THIRD passenger injured as well...ALL FELL AT THE SAME PLACE!

The FIRST passenger to fall and my husband had to be treated in the Emergency Room at the nearby hospital. My husband was taken BY AMBULANCE to the emergency room for treatment.
Ms. Mary Jones, a Holland America representative, called and spoke with my husband in early October (coindidentally the same day I posted my first query to Pissedconsumer.com) and that's been it!!!

I have sent the estimates for replacing his teeth as well as pictures of the unsafe area we passengers were forced to walk on. Regarding the teeth and his injuries - FOUR teeth were knocked out, his nose was broken as well as his jaw being broken and requiring stitches inside his lower lip to sew it up!!!

Summary

Holland America Line is a large cruise travel company. It was founded in 1873. Its headquarters is based in Seattle, Washington. The company is owned by Carnival Corporation & plc. Holland America Line’s fleet consists of 15 ships which sail to 415 ports in 98 countries. The company offers over 500 cruise tours all over the world annually. There are cruises to Europe, New Zealand, the Amazon, Antarctica, Alaska and many more destinations. Extended Grand Voyages lasting over 100 days are also available.
